Tree Edging Installation in Citrus County, FL
Tree edging installation involves creating a defined border around trees to enhance the landscape's appearance and protect the root zone. This service typically covers projects such as installing brick, stone, or metal edging around individual trees, landscaped beds, or tree islands. Property owners often seek this service to improve curb appeal, prevent grass and mulch from spreading into the root area, and create a clean, organized look in yards and gardens.
Before requesting tree edging installation, homeowners should consider factors such as the type of edging material preferred, the size and type of trees involved, and the overall landscape design goals. It’s also helpful to understand the existing soil conditions and any necessary preparation work to ensure the edging is durable and properly installed. Clear communication about these aspects can help achieve a finished result that complements the property’s aesthetic and functional needs.

Tree Edging Installation Questions
What is tree edging installation? It involves creating a defined border around trees to enhance appearance and protect the root zone.
Why consider tree edging for a property? It helps prevent grass and weeds from encroaching on tree bases and adds a neat, finished look to landscaping.
What materials are used for tree edging? Common options include metal, plastic, stone, or wood, chosen based on style and durability preferences.
Is tree edging suitable for all types of trees? Yes, it can be installed around most trees to improve aesthetics and protect roots, regardless of size or species.
